優化網站效能的五個必備策略
隨著網路科技的不斷發展和普及,網站已經成為企業和個人展示自己的重要視窗。然而,擁有一個美觀和功能強大的網站並不足以保證用戶的滿意度。網站效能是使用者體驗的關鍵因素之一,一旦網站速度緩慢或回應時間過長,會導致訪客流失和交易失敗。為了提升網站效能,以下是五個必備的優化策略。
一、優化圖片
圖片是網站中常見的資源之一,它們可以大大提高網站的吸引力和可讀性。然而,大尺寸或未經優化的圖像會導致網站載入速度變慢。因此,在上傳圖像之前,需要對圖像進行壓縮和優化。可以使用專業的影像處理工具,如Photoshop或線上影像最佳化工具,來壓縮影像大小並保持良好的影像品質。此外,使用適當的圖像格式,如JPEG或PNG,並確保圖像路徑正確,以避免載入錯誤。
二、使用快取技術
快取是一種儲存資料的技術,可以讓再次造訪相同頁面時,網站快速載入。透過使用瀏覽器快取、伺服器快取或內容分發網路(CDN)等快取機制,可以減少網站伺服器的負載壓力,並提高網站載入速度。瀏覽器快取可以儲存網站靜態資源,如圖像、CSS和JavaScript文件,減少對伺服器的請求。而伺服器快取可以快取動態頁面,避免重複的資料庫查詢和運算。使用CDN可以將網站內容分佈至全球多個節點,減少網路延遲。
三、壓縮和合併文件
網站中的文件,如CSS和JavaScript,通常是用來控制網頁樣式和互動行為的。然而,過多的文件和非優化的程式碼會導致網站請求變多,從而降低網站效能。透過壓縮和合併這些文件,可以減少文件大小和數量,從而提高網站載入速度。可以使用CSS壓縮工具和JavaScript壓縮工具來縮小檔案大小。同時,合併多個CSS和JavaScript檔案為一個檔案可以減少HTTP請求。
四、優化資料庫
對於使用資料庫驅動的網站,優化資料庫查詢和操作是非常重要的。透過使用索引、最佳化查詢語句以及限制資料庫操作的頻率和數量,可以減少資料庫負荷,提高網站的回應速度。此外,定期清理和優化資料庫,刪除不必要的資料和表,可以進一步提升資料庫效能。使用快取技術也可以將部分資料快取至記憶體中,減少對資料庫的存取。
五、減少HTTP請求
每個HTTP請求都需要伺服器處理和傳回結果,因此減少HTTP請求可以大幅提升網站效能。可以透過合併檔案、使用CSS Sprite(CSS精靈)和使用資料URI(將圖片轉碼為Base64編碼)等技術來減少網站的檔案數量和HTTP請求次數。同時,優化網頁程式碼,刪除冗餘和不必要的程式碼,可以減少網頁的大小,從而減少HTTP請求。
總結起來,優化網站效能是一個複雜的過程,需要綜合考慮多個因素。透過優化圖片、使用快取技術、壓縮和合併檔案、優化資料庫以及減少HTTP請求,可以有效提高網站的回應速度和使用者體驗。透過遵循這五個必備策略,網站可以更快地載入並提供更好的用戶體驗。
以上是五條必須遵守的優化網站效能策略的詳細內容。更多資訊請關注PHP中文網其他相關文章!